EqualLogic chat transcript from 2/4/2008. Additional Q&A can be found on the EqualLogic FAQ page.
Travis Vigil is a Product Marketing Strategist for Dell's iSCSI solutions. He has nearly 10 years of experience with technology companies including Intel and Dell, and was most recently responsible for the launch of Dell EqualLogic iSCSI arrays. He received a B.S. from Stanford University and an M.B.A from Northwestern University's Kellogg School of Management.
Marc Farley joined Dell in January 2008 as part of the EqualLogic acquisition. He is a well-respected authority on network storage technologies and the author of two books : Building Storage Networks and Storage Networking Fundamentals. His network storage career began in 1991 at Palindrome Corp, an early developer of LAN backup software. Marc holds a B.S. in Physics from the University of Washington.
